Transaction edf95e2febe69fc101ed16a9ed380a03d813bad9fdd342df723a4561f889d5c8
1 Input
1 Output
-
edf95e2febe69fc101ed16a9ed380a03d813bad9fdd342df723a4561f889d5c8:0
- value
- 10948577206
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2c20df6ec295bbb8470fde10496cb9092584a921 OP_EQUALVERIFY OP_CHECKSIG
- address
- 152L7Uw6urcQHTwEeukDD7RBRgywBua9Hy